Committee on World Food Security has a new Chair
©FAO/Alessandra Benedetti
11 October, Rome –Ambassador Gerda Verburg of the Netherlands will succeed Ambassador Yaya Olaniran of Nigeria as Chair for the Committee on World Food Security (CFS). The announcement came today during the close of CFS week. Ms Verburg is a Dutch diplomat and former Minister of Agriculture for the Netherlands. Since 2011, she has served as the Permanent Representative of the Netherlands to FAO Headquarters in Rome and has been active in the Organization’s Governing Bodies.

CFS is to be the most inclusive international and intergovernmental platform for all stakeholders to work together to ensure food security and nutrition for all. In the following interview, Ms Verburg explains what needs to be done next by the CFS.
